Abstract

To provide a gravure rotary printing machine comprising a furnisher roll contacting a plate cylinder, which can suppress ink from scattering to an end face of the plate cylinder and an axis of the furnisher roll.SOLUTION: In a gravure rotary printing machine, a furnisher roll is constituted of a columnar part at a center part and a truncated cone-shape part at a side part. In the truncated cone-shape part at the side part, a small-diameter surface becomes an end part of the furnisher roll and a large diameter part contacts the columnar part at the center part of the furnisher roll. The diameter of the large diameter surface is equal to the diameter of the columnar part at the center part of the furnisher roll. In a direction of an axis of the furnisher roll, an end part of a plate cylinder is positioned at the truncated cone-shape part at the side part of the furnisher roll.SELECTED DRAWING: Figure 1

Conventionally, a gravure rotary printing press has a printing unit shown in FIG. 4, in which a plate cylinder and a finisher roll are shown in FIG. 3 ((a) is a perspective view and (b) is a top view). The configuration is as shown, and as is schematically shown in FIGS. 4 and 3, printing of the gravure rotary printing press is performed by the following steps.
(P1) The finisher roll 91 partially immersed in the ink 5 of the ink pan 4 rotates to supply the ink 5 to the plate cylinder 2.
(P2) The supplied ink 5 forms an ink sump 7 at the contact portion between the plate cylinder 2 and the finisher roll 91.
(P3) Ink 5 enters the pattern portion of the plate cylinder 2.
(P4) The doctor 20 removes the excess ink 5.
(P5) Nip the impression cylinder roll 10 and the plate cylinder 2 to transfer the ink 5 to the printing substrate 30.
(P6) The ink in the ink sump 7 accumulated in the contact portion between the plate cylinder 2 and the finisher roll 91 in (P2) flows down toward both ends. At that time, there was a problem that the ink 5 was scattered and adhered to the plate body end surface 51 and the finisher roll shaft 92, and it took a long time to clean after the end of production.

Printing of the gravure rotary printing press according to the present invention is performed by the following steps.
(S1) The finisher roll 1 partially immersed in the ink 5 of the ink pan 4 rotates to supply the ink 5 to the plate cylinder 2.
(S2) The supplied ink 5 forms an ink pool 7 at a contact portion between the plate cylinder 2 and the finisher roll 1.
(S3) Ink 5 enters the pattern portion of the plate cylinder 2.
(S4) The doctor 20 removes the excess ink 5.
(S5) Nip the impression cylinder roll, 10 and the plate cylinder 2 to transfer the ink 5 to the printing substrate 30.
Ink pool 7 is formed in the columnar portion 200 at the contact portion between the plate cylinder 2 and the finisher roll 1 in (S6) and (S2). The ink 5 goes to both ends. Since the truncated cone-shaped portions 100 are provided at both ends of the finisher roll 1, the ink 5 flows down along this inclination to the plate body end surface 51 and the finisher roll shaft 40 on the side of the plate body end portion 50. The scattering and adhesion of the ink 5 of the above are reduced. It is possible to shorten the cleaning time when production is stopped.
